Just switched from Saxon via Execute Command to the official Saxon Configurator. My old situation can be seen here:
http://forum.enfocus.com/viewtopic.php?f=12&t=1201
With the old situation I am running Saxon HE 9.6.0.4 Java Edition. With Enfocus writing "On Windows configurator searches for .Net version of the processor first and only in case nothing is found it searches for Java version." I decided to switch to the .Net installation. Version 9.7 is not available as .Net yet, so I got 9.6.0.8.
http://sourceforge.net/projects/saxon/f ... on-HE/9.6/ (SaxonHE9-6-0-8N-setup.exe).
I only set the Stylesheet value in properties, and the output is exactly the same as my original setup.
